As one of the fastest-growing academic health centers in the nation, the Texas A&M University Health Science Center encompasses five colleges and numerous centers and institutes working together to improve health through transformative education, innovative research and team-based health care delivery.
A part of the Texas A&M University Health Science Center, Texas A&M College of Dentistry in Dallas was founded in 1905 and is a nationally recognized center for oral health sciences education, research, specialized patient care and continuing dental education.

Responsibilities:
-
Greet patients and schedules appointments in person or by phone with a friendly manner. Confers with patient regarding current charges and answers any questions they may have.
-
Collects payments for services. Confirms all scheduled appointments 48 hours in advance for Facial Pain, Sleep Medicine, and Center for Maxillofacial Prosthodontics. Supports other front desk activities as needed for multiple clinics. Confirms all scheduled patient appointments 48 hours in advance for Facial pain, Sleep Medicine and Center for Maxillofacial Prosthodontics.
-
Update patient demographics in the electronic dental record while maintaining security and confidentiality of patient information and finances while maintaining a computerized appointments system for multiple doctors in accordance with distributed calendars, guidelines, and individual requests.
-
Ability to back up and/ or fill in for other front desk personnel or assistants in the clinic.
-
Develop a working understanding of the practice and procedures at the clinic and clearly convey them to patients while addressing all questions in a professional and coherent manner.
